AI Technical Summary

Technical Problem

Minors are prone to accidents when using ice cream vending machines due to accidental contact with the internal equipment, and current technology lacks effective safety protection measures.

Method used

An internal casing is installed inside the vending machine. The side walls of the casing are made of panels, perforated plates, or mesh structures to restrict the user's hand movement space and prevent contact with mechanical and electrical structures. The casing is equipped with a viewing window and operating device. The material container is made of transparent material, and the goods enter the self-service space through the casing.

Benefits of technology

This improves equipment safety, protects customer safety, avoids hand contact with internal structures, and enhances safety during use.

Description

TECHNICAL FIELD

[0001] The utility model relates to automatic vending machine technical field especially, it is a kind of self-taking space safety protection structure for automatic vending machine. BACKGROUND

[0002] Ice cream vending machine becomes the common automatic vending equipment of places such as shopping mall, entertainment, public transport, and it realizes the automatic supply function of article after customer payment through internal automation mechanical structure, electrical structure.

[0003] Taking ice cream vending machine as an example, in the customer use process, the hand of customer enters the self-taking space inside ice cream vending machine to obtain ice cream, this action makes customer contact with ice cream vending machine, for customer, some adult customers have good safety consciousness, can use normally, but for some minors, for the equipment inside full of curiosity, it is easy to cause safety accident with internal equipment due to miscontact, not only cause damage to equipment, seriously it can also threaten the personal safety of customer, based on this consequence, manufacturer needs to be more rigorous in the safety protection of equipment, more comprehensive in product design. SUMMARY

[0004] In order to solve the deficiency in the prior art, the utility model provides a self-taking space safety protection structure for automatic vending machine for increasing the safety of automatic vending machine in use.

[0005] The technical scheme adopted by the utility model to solve its technical problems is:

[0006] A self-taking space safety protection structure for automatic vending machine, comprising automatic vending machine body and its door body, self-taking space, characterized in that:

[0007] The self-taking space is located inside a shell, and the shell is installed inside the automatic vending machine body.

[0008] The front side of the shell is an open structure, and is arranged corresponding to the taking opening of the door body, for hand to enter the self-taking space for use.

[0009] The bottom of the shell is an open structure, for goods to enter the self-taking space for use.

[0010] The side wall of the shell adopts panel structure or hole plate structure or mesh structure.

[0011] The upper portion of the shell is further provided with a mounting chamber, and the top of the mounting chamber is provided with a cover body detachably connected with the shell.

[0012] The side wall of the front side of the mounting chamber is provided with a visual window communicating with the inside thereof.

[0013] At least one group of material containers is arranged in the installation chamber, and the material containers are made of transparent material.

[0014] The housing is further provided with a working device, which is installed at the bottom end of the side wall of the housing and located at the upper part of the commodity walking mechanism of the vending machine body.

[0015] The beneficial effects of the present application are: the structure is reasonable, by increasing the housing inside the vending machine, when the customer's hand enters the inside of the vending machine to get the goods, the activity space of the user's hand can be effectively limited, and the possibility of the customer's hand contacting the mechanical structure and electrical structure inside the vending machine is effectively blocked, the safety factor of the equipment is greatly improved, and the personal safety of the customer is ensured. DETAILED DESCRIPTION

[0021] The embodiments of the present application will be described below by specific examples, and those skilled in the art can easily understand other advantages and effects of the present application from the contents disclosed in the present specification.

[0022] According to Figs. 1 to 3The embodiment provides a self-taking space safety protection structure for a vending machine, which comprises a vending machine body 100, a door body 101 of the vending machine body 100, a self-taking space, a mechanical structure and an electrical structure of the vending machine body 100 which are mainly installed in the interior of the vending machine body 100, the door body 101 is located at the front side of the vending machine body 100, and the self-taking space is arranged in the interior of the vending machine body 100 and close to the door body 101 at the front side. In order to guarantee the safety of the hands of a customer at the position of the self-taking space, a shell 200 is further arranged in the interior of the vending machine body 100, the self-taking space is located in the interior of the shell 200, the side wall of the shell 200 adopts a panel structure, the hands can be prevented from entering a position with a safety risk through the shell 200, of course, the side wall of the shell 200 can also adopt a hole plate structure or a mesh structure, and only the opening size of the side wall needs to be limited. The specific implementation structure of the shell 200 is described below.

[0023] The shell 200 is similar to a cuboid in shape, the shell 200 is arranged close to a taking opening 102 of the door body 101 and is located at the inner side of the taking opening 102, the left side wall of the shell 200 is connected and fixed with the inner wall of the vending machine body 100, and the right side wall of the shell 200 is connected and fixed with the inner wall of the vending machine body 100.

[0024] The front side of the shell 200 is a front opening 203 of an open structure, the size of the front opening 203 covers nearly half of the area of the front side wall, the front opening 203 is square in shape and covers the edge of the taking opening 102, is used for the hands to enter the self-taking space from the taking opening 102 and use, and can also be used for the hands to freely leave the self-taking space when goods are obtained.

[0025] The bottom of the shell 200 is a lower opening 202 of an open structure, the lower opening 202 is circular in shape, the front side edge of the lower opening 202 is in communication with the front opening 203, and the size of the lower opening 202 is slightly larger than the size of a product cup in a cup holder 501 and is used for goods to enter the self-taking space and use.

[0026] The upper portion of the shell 200 is further provided with a mounting cavity, the internal space of the mounting cavity is independently arranged, a cover 201 which is detachably connected with the shell 200 is arranged at the top of the mounting cavity, a visual window 204 in communication with the interior of the mounting cavity is arranged on the side wall of the front side of the mounting cavity, two groups of material containers 600 are arranged in the mounting cavity, the material containers 600 are arranged side by side in front of and behind each other, and the material containers 600 are made of transparent material; meanwhile, two groups of operation devices 700 are arranged on the shell 200, the operation devices 700 are shower head assemblies, the operation devices 700 are arranged at the bottom end of the right side wall of the shell 200 and are located at the upper portion of the product walking mechanism 500.

[0027] In the structure, the shell 200 is installed based on certain installation conditions, can be integrated with other components, the material container 600 and the operation device 700 are integrated on the shell 200, the material container 600 uses the shell 200 as an installation platform and is protected by the cover 201, so that the material container 600 is effectively prevented from being interfered and polluted by external components, and the operation device 700 component is installed on the side wall of the shell 200, the material container 600 is communicated with the operation device 700 through the conveying component and the conveying pipeline, so that chocolate color needles and decorative sugar beads in the material container 600 can be uniformly arranged on ice cream, and each component does not need to be separately provided with an installation component, thereby saving assembly space and cost.

[0028] A self-taking space safety protection structure for the vending machine can meet the horizontal and vertical movement of the cup holder 501 in the initial position, can obtain the product cup at the cup holder 400, and can move the product cup to the ice cream below the machine head 300 of the vending machine body 100 to obtain the ice cream, then decorates in the operation device 700 position in the process of moving to the lower opening 202 position, and finally enters the inside of the shell 200 to be taken away by the customer for eating, in the process, the hand of the customer can only contact the inside of the shell 200 when obtaining the ice cream, and cannot contact the internal mechanical structure and electrical structure of the vending machine, so that the safety factor of the equipment is greatly improved, and the personal safety of the customer is ensured.
